Dante Campbell (born May 22, 1999) is a Canadian-Jamaican professional soccer player, currently playing for Toronto FC II.[1]

Club career

Campbell played for the Toronto FC youth academy in the Premier Development League for the 2016 season. He made 10 appearances with no goals.

On July 31, 2016, he made his professional debut in the United Soccer League for the Toronto FC second team in a 3–2 away win over Bethlehem Steel, coming on as a 67th-minute substitute for Sal Bernal.[2]
